CVE-2021-1379 | Cisco IP Phones with Multiplatform Cisco Discovery Protocol buffer overflow (cisco-sa-ipphone-rce-dos-U2PsSkz3)
A vulnerability identified as critical has been detected in Cisco IP Phones with Multiplatform, Session Initiation Protocol Software and Small Business IP Phones. This affects an unknown function of the component Cisco Discovery Protocol/Link Layer Discovery Protocol. This manipulation causes buffer overflow.
This vulnerability is tracked as CVE-2021-1379. The attack is possible to be carried out remotely. No exploit exists.
You should upgrade the affected component.
